Warning Signs You Need Skylight Leak Water Removal

Ignoring these warning signs can lead to costly repairs and structural issues. Don’t wait until it’s too late – address these signs quickly to prevent further damage.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ors can be a sign of moisture buildup and mold growth. If you notice persistent musty smells, it’s essential to investigate and address the issue quickly to prevent further damage and health risks.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ains can be a sign of a leaky skylight or roof issue. If you notice water stains, it’s crucial to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Warped or Buckled Roofing Materials

Warped or buckled roofing materials can be a sign of water damage and structural issues. If you notice these signs,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Increased Energy Bills

Increased energy bills can be a sign of moisture buildup and heat loss. If you notice a sudden spike in your energy bills, it’s essential to investigate and address the issue quickly to prevent further damage and save on energy costs.

Visible Signs of Mold or Mildew

Visible signs of mold or mildew can be a sign of moisture buildup and health risks. If you notice these signs,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age and health risks.

Unexplained Noises or Creaks

Unexplained noises or creaks can be a sign of structural issues and water damage. If you notice these signs,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Skylight Leak Water Removal Cost in Bellaire, TX

The cost of skylight leak water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Bellaire, TX. Here’s a general estimate of the costs you might incur: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Amount of water present, size of affected area, and equipment needed.
Skylight repair or replacement $1,000 – $5,000 Size of skylight, type of materials needed, and complexity of repairs.
Mold or mildew remediation $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of mold or mildew present, and equipment needed.
Emergency services (24/7) $200 – $1,000 Time of day, severity of the situation, and equipment needed.
Free estimates and consultations $0 – $100 Complexity of the issue, size of affected area, and time required for the consultation.

Keep in mind that these estimates are general and may vary depending on your specific situation. Our team will provide a detailed estimate after assessing the damage and developing a customized plan for your skylight leak water removal needs.
